[R]eviewed: Intense Carbine 29 Expert

janv. 2019 · Matt Holmes

Intense’s Carbine has a relatively short lineage, albeit one that has been part of Intense’s move from a race only frame builder to complete bike company pushing out some of the industries most revered carbon frames. Back in 2011, it was a little 26-inch shod, 140mm to 152mm travel all-mountain frame that brought with it a whole new level of stiffness and durability to the Intense line-up. It was also their first step away from aluminium, bar a very short […]

Géométrie
Spécifications
Construire
Cadre

Carbine 29” Enduro Optimized Carbon Frame. Carbon top link, internal shift, dropper post and brake routing. ISCG05 mounts, flak guard armor, 155mm travel

Norme BBBB86/BB92, Appuyez sur Fit

CouleurWhite

Fourche

DVO Diamond D3 160mm Travel, 44mm offset, Boost 110x15mm, Quick Release Axle

Voyager160mm

Amortisseur arrière

DVO Topaz 1 Air 230mm X 60mm (9.05” X 2.4”), 3-position (open/mid/firm)

Voyager155mm

Pédalier

SHIMANO BB92

Casque

Tange Seiki ZS44-EC49/40

Tige

ETHIRTEEN Base 35mm X 40mm

Guidon

ETHIRTEEN Base 35mm X 800mm

Selle

SDG Radar

Tige de selle

INTENSE Recon 31.6mm dropper, 150mm MD-LG / 170mm XL

TypeCompte-gouttes

Poignées

INTENSE

Groupe
Derailleur arriere

SHIMANO SLX 12SP

Manivelle

SHIMANO FC-M611 / 32T / 170mm / Boost

Manettes

SHIMANO SLX 12SP I-Spec

Cassette

SHIMANO Deore 12SP / 11-51T

Chaîne

SHIMANO Deore 12SP

Freins

SHIMANO M6120 Front (Four Piston) 203mm Rotors / SHIMANO M6120 Rear (Four Piston) 203mm Rotors

TypeShimano Deore Disque hydraulique

roues
Jantes

ETHIRTEEN LG1 Enduro Alloy 30mm Rim INTENSE Alloy Hub/ Boost

Moyeu avant

INTENSE Alloy hubs 32 Hole 15x110 front, 12x148 rear hub 6-bolt

Moyeu arrière

INTENSE Alloy hubs 32 Hole 15x110 front, 12x148 rear hub 6-bolt

Pneus

Front: MAXXIS Minion DHF WT Exo+ 29"x 2.5”, Rear: MAXXIS Minion DHR II WT Exo+ 29"x 2.4”
